服务器如何配置时钟同步
-
服务器时钟同步是确保服务器时间准确的重要步骤。准确的服务器时间对于各种系统和应用程序的正常运行非常重要,特别是在多服务器环境下。以下是服务器如何配置时钟同步的步骤:
-
使用NTP协议:网络时间协议(NTP)是一种用于同步网络中计算机时钟的协议。大多数操作系统都支持NTP协议,因此通过配置服务器使用NTP协议可以很容易地实现时钟同步。服务器可以从公共NTP服务器、GPS接收器或其他服务器同步时间。
-
选择可靠的时间源:选择可靠的时间源对于时钟同步非常重要。公共NTP服务器通常具有可靠的时间源,可以从互联网上选择合适的服务器进行时间同步。此外,如果网络环境允许,可以设置本地的Stratum 1 NTP服务器作为时间源。Stratum 1服务器是由GPS接收器、原子钟或其他可靠的时间源提供时间信号。
-
配置时间服务器:服务器可以配置为使用特定的NTP服务器进行时间同步。在Linux操作系统中,可以编辑“/etc/ntp.conf”文件并添加NTP服务器的地址。在Windows操作系统中,可以通过控制面板的时间和日期设置中配置NTP服务器。
-
防火墙设置:如果服务器后面有防火墙,确保防火墙允许NTP协议的流量通过。NTP使用UDP协议的端口123进行通信,因此确保防火墙允许此端口的入站和出站流量。
-
检查时钟同步状态:配置好时钟同步后,需要定期检查时钟同步的状态。可以使用命令行工具(如ntpq或ntpstat)或GUI工具(如ntpd或w32time)来检查服务器的时钟同步状态。如果发现时钟同步问题,可以查看日志文件以了解问题的原因并进行排查。
-
定期更新时间源:定期更新时间源是保持服务器时间准确的关键。可以定期检查和更新服务器配置的NTP服务器列表,确保使用最新可靠的时间源进行同步。
总之,服务器的时钟同步是确保服务器时间准确的重要步骤。通过配置服务器使用NTP协议、选择可靠的时间源、配置时间服务器、设置防火墙规则、定期检查时钟同步状态,并定期更新时间源,可以实现有效的时钟同步。这样可以确保服务器的时间准确,从而保证各种系统和应用程序的正常运行。
1年前 -
-
配置服务器时钟同步是确保服务器时间始终准确同步的重要步骤。在服务器集群或分布式系统中,服务器之间的时间同步至关重要,以确保事件的顺序和协调正确。下面是配置服务器时钟同步的几种方法:
-
使用网络时间协议(NTP):NTP是一种网络协议,用于同步计算机的系统时间。它通过网络连接到时间服务器,自动更新和调整本地时间。要配置服务器使用NTP进行时钟同步,您需要在服务器上安装并启动NTP服务,然后配置ntp.conf文件,指定要使用的时间服务器。
-
使用时间服务器:您可以选择连接到公共时间服务器,这些服务器由各个组织维护并提供给大众使用。例如,NIST(美国国家标准与技术研究院)和其它权威机构提供免费的公共时间服务器。
-
使用本地时钟源:在某些情况下,您可能需要使用局域网中的某个服务器作为时钟源,该服务器具有准确的时间源。您可以将此服务器配置为其他服务器的时间源,以确保它们的时间同步。
-
使用GPS时钟:全球定位系统(GPS)提供准确的时间信息,可以用于同步服务器时钟。您可以通过将GPS接收器连接到服务器,使用GPS提供的时间信号进行时钟同步。
-
使用硬件时钟同步设备:有一些硬件设备可以用于时钟同步,例如网络时钟同步设备、原子钟等。这些设备提供高精度的时钟信号,并确保服务器的时间与其保持同步。
配置服务器时钟同步时,还需要注意以下几点:
-
配置主从服务器:在服务器集群中,通常会有一个主服务器和多个从服务器。主服务器应该配置为时间源,并通过NTP或其他方法将时间同步到从服务器。
-
设置定期同步:建议定期同步服务器的时钟,以确保时间保持准确。可以将同步间隔设置为几小时、每天或每周一次,具体取决于实际需求。
-
检查时间源的准确性:确保所使用的时间源是准确可靠的,以避免错误的时间同步。
-
监控时钟同步状态:定期检查服务器的时钟同步状态,以确保时间同步正常工作。可以使用NTP服务器的日志文件或其他工具来监视时钟同步状态。
-
处理时钟偏差:如果服务器的时钟与时间源存在较大偏差,可能需要手动调整时钟。这可以通过手动设置时间或重新同步服务器来完成。
总结起来,配置服务器时钟同步是确保服务器时间准确同步的重要步骤。使用NTP、时间服务器、GPS时钟、硬件设备等方式来同步服务器时钟,并注意配置主从服务器、定期同步、检查时间源准确性、监控时钟同步状态和处理时钟偏差等要点。
1年前 -
-
服务器配置时钟同步非常重要,因为服务器的时钟同步会影响到许多服务和应用的正常运行。在配置时钟同步时,可以使用网络时间协议(NTP)来自动同步服务器的时钟。下面是服务器配置时钟同步的方法和操作流程:
-
选择合适的时间服务器:在配置时钟同步之前,首先需要选择合适的时间服务器。时间服务器分为官方时间服务器和公共时间服务器两种类型。官方时间服务器由相关机构和组织提供,具有更高的准确性和稳定性,适用于需要高度准确时间同步的应用。公共时间服务器是由各个组织、单位或个人提供,准确性和稳定性可能有所不同。
-
安装和配置NTP服务:NTP是一种用于时间同步的协议,常用于服务器和网络设备之间的时间同步。在服务器上安装和配置NTP服务,可以实现服务器自动与时间服务器进行时间同步。
-
Ubuntu / Debian系统:
- 安装NTP服务:
sudo apt-get install ntp - 配置NTP服务器:
sudo nano /etc/ntp.conf - 在配置文件中添加时间服务器的IP地址,例如:
server ntp.example.com - 保存并关闭配置文件
- 重新启动NTP服务:
sudo service ntp restart
- 安装NTP服务:
-
CentOS / RHEL系统:
- 安装NTP服务:
sudo yum install ntp - 配置NTP服务器:
sudo vi /etc/ntp.conf - 在配置文件中添加时间服务器的IP地址,例如:
server ntp.example.com - 保存并关闭配置文件
- 启动NTP服务:
sudo systemctl start ntpd - 设置NTP服务开机自启动:
sudo systemctl enable ntpd
- 安装NTP服务:
-
-
配置NTP客户端:完成NTP服务的配置后,服务器将自动与时间服务器进行时间同步。但是,为了确保服务正常运行,需要在客户端系统上配置NTP同步。
-
Ubuntu / Debian系统:
- 安装NTP客户端:
sudo apt-get install ntpdate - 配置NTP服务器:
sudo nano /etc/ntp.conf - 在配置文件中添加时间服务器的IP地址,例如:
server ntp.example.com - 保存并关闭配置文件
- 手动同步时间:
sudo ntpdate ntp.example.com - 设置自动同步时间的计划任务:
sudo crontab -e,添加一行*/5 * * * * /usr/sbin/ntpdate ntp.example.com
- 安装NTP客户端:
-
CentOS / RHEL系统:
- 安装NTP客户端:
sudo yum install ntpdate - 配置NTP服务器:
sudo vi /etc/ntp.conf - 在配置文件中添加时间服务器的IP地址,例如:
server ntp.example.com - 保存并关闭配置文件
- 手动同步时间:
sudo ntpdate ntp.example.com - 设置自动同步时间的计划任务:
sudo crontab -e,添加一行*/5 * * * * /usr/sbin/ntpdate ntp.example.com
- 安装NTP客户端:
-
-
验证时钟同步:完成配置后,可以验证时钟同步是否成功。
- 执行命令
ntpq -p,可以查看当前服务器和时间服务器之间的连接状态和时间同步情况。 - 执行命令
date,可以查看服务器的当前时间。
- 执行命令
在配置时钟同步时,还需要注意以下几点:
- 选择靠谱的时间服务器:确保时间服务器的准确性和稳定性,以确保时钟同步正常运行。
- 服务器定期同步时间:建议服务器定期同步时间,以确保时钟同步的连续性和准确性。
- 监控时钟同步:定期检查和监控服务器的时钟同步情况,及时发现和解决问题。
通过以上方法和操作流程,可以正确地配置服务器的时钟同步,从而保证服务器的时间准确性和应用服务的正常运行。
1年前 -